[Enhancement] Make "Highlight only current branch" feature available for any branch #1703

The "Highlight only current branch" is an excellent feature, but unfortunately it's a bit too "blunt" of a tool since we have to switch to a specific branch in order to use it.

It would have been MUCH more useful if it could quickly be enabled for ANY branch (even remote ones), without requiring it to be a) a local branch and b) the current one...

This should also be a trivial fix to implement, the most difficult part would probably be to decide upon the UI for activating it. (Initially it could be just for a single branch at a time, like the original feature, but ideally it could work more similar to the visibility filter so that multiple branches could be "highlighted" - i.e colored, while the rest are gray...)
